Starsector API
|
Public Member Functions | |
void | advance (float amount, List< InputEventAPI > events) |
void | renderInUICoords (ViewportAPI viewport) |
void | init (CombatEngineAPI engine) |
void | renderInWorldCoords (ViewportAPI viewport) |
void | processInputPreCoreControls (float amount, List< InputEventAPI > events) |
Definition at line 7 of file BaseEveryFrameCombatPlugin.java.
void com.fs.starfarer.api.combat.BaseEveryFrameCombatPlugin.advance | ( | float | amount, |
List< InputEventAPI > | events | ||
) |
Implements com.fs.starfarer.api.combat.EveryFrameCombatPlugin.
Definition at line 9 of file BaseEveryFrameCombatPlugin.java.
void com.fs.starfarer.api.combat.BaseEveryFrameCombatPlugin.init | ( | CombatEngineAPI | engine | ) |
Deprecated, not guaranteed to be called before advance() is called for an EveryFrameCombatPlugin. Can still be relied on if the EveryFrameCombatPlugin.advance() method checks for any fields being set in init() being null.
engine |
Implements com.fs.starfarer.api.combat.CombatEnginePlugin.
Definition at line 15 of file BaseEveryFrameCombatPlugin.java.
void com.fs.starfarer.api.combat.BaseEveryFrameCombatPlugin.processInputPreCoreControls | ( | float | amount, |
List< InputEventAPI > | events | ||
) |
Implements com.fs.starfarer.api.combat.EveryFrameCombatPlugin.
Definition at line 23 of file BaseEveryFrameCombatPlugin.java.
void com.fs.starfarer.api.combat.BaseEveryFrameCombatPlugin.renderInUICoords | ( | ViewportAPI | viewport | ) |
Implements com.fs.starfarer.api.combat.EveryFrameCombatPlugin.
Definition at line 12 of file BaseEveryFrameCombatPlugin.java.
void com.fs.starfarer.api.combat.BaseEveryFrameCombatPlugin.renderInWorldCoords | ( | ViewportAPI | viewport | ) |
Implements com.fs.starfarer.api.combat.EveryFrameCombatPlugin.
Definition at line 19 of file BaseEveryFrameCombatPlugin.java.